Digital backup storage offers multiple benefits for Tesla repair documentation. First, it ensures data redundancy, protecting against hardware failures or natural disasters that could destroy physical records. For instance, a fire at a workshop containing hard copies of Tesla repair manuals would be devastating. Digitization not only preserves but also facilitates quick retrieval, enabling technicians to access the latest service information promptly. This accessibility is vital during complex repairs where every second counts. Furthermore, cloud-based storage solutions allow for real-time updates, ensuring that all team members work with the most current data. This collaboration enhances efficiency and reduces errors in vehicle repair processes.
Implementing a digital backup system requires strategic planning. Businesses should choose secure cloud platforms designed to handle sensitive information. Encryption techniques and access controls are essential to protect intellectual property and customer privacy. Additionally, creating structured folders and using standardized naming conventions for files can significantly improve the organization of Tesla repair documentation. For instance, categorizing documents by vehicle model, year, and specific repair type streamlines the retrieval process. Regular data backups, ideally automated, guarantee that no critical information is left vulnerable to loss or damage.
